Florence is renowned as the birthplace of the Muscle Shoals sound, a legendary chapter in American music history. Living in Pearces Mills places you just minutes from landmarks like FAME Recording Studios and the Alabama Music Hall of Fame. Beyond the music, the area boasts a deep connection to the Tennessee River and the legacy of Helen Keller, offering a unique living environment where history and modern community life beautifully intersect.

Transportation & Connectivity
Pearces Mills enjoys excellent connectivity for both local travel and regional trips. The neighborhood is conveniently located near major roads like US-72 and US-43, providing straightforward routes to downtown Florence, Sheffield, Muscle Shoals, and Tuscumbia. Commutes within the Shoals area are typically short and hassle-free, a significant perk for daily life.
For longer journeys, the Northwest Alabama Regional Airport (MSL) offers connecting flights, while the larger Huntsville International Airport (HSV) is about an hour and a half's drive to the east. While public transit options within Florence are limited, the city's layout is very car-friendly. The central location also makes road trips to Nashville, Memphis, Birmingham, and the Gulf Coast a feasible and popular weekend endeavor.
